Valuation: Balfour Beatty plc

Capitalization 3.72B 5.07B 4.27B 3.9B 6.91B 460B 7.17B 45.25B 17.94B 221B 19B 18.62B 775B P/E ratio 2025 *
17.8x
P/E ratio 2026 * 16.2x
Enterprise value 2.77B 3.79B 3.19B 2.91B 5.16B 343B 5.36B 33.78B 13.39B 165B 14.19B 13.9B 579B EV / Sales 2025 *
0.27x
EV / Sales 2026 * 0.25x
Free-Float
95.74%
Yield 2025 *
1.76%
Yield 2026 * 1.91%
1 day+1.12%
1 week+3.02%
Current month+7.35%
1 month+7.73%
3 months+16.31%
6 months+36.88%
Current year+7.81%
1 week 738.5
Extreme 738.5
774
1 month 705.5
Extreme 705.5
774
Current year 700
Extreme 700
774
1 year 365.8
Extreme 365.8
774
3 years 291.6
Extreme 291.6
774
5 years 207.8
Extreme 207.8
774
10 years 165.3
Extreme 165.3
774
Manager TitleAgeSince
Chief Executive Officer 56 2025-09-07
Director of Finance/CFO 65 2015-05-31
Chief Investment Officer 45 -
Director TitleAgeSince
Director/Board Member 65 2015-05-31
Director/Board Member 68 2017-05-31
Director/Board Member 70 2018-11-30
Change 5d. change 1-year change 3-years change Capi.($)
+1.12%+3.02%+64.27%+111.97% 5.07B
+0.97%+0.82%+24.87%+25.72% 88.98B
+1.59%+3.14%+83.60%+239.87% 78.15B
-0.21%+2.59%+28.87%+90.62% 63.37B
-1.42%+2.17%+43.24%+123.24% 52.3B
+2.92%+8.75%+241.99%+993.19% 47.09B
+2.29%+4.77%+87.86%+444.74% 35.85B
+1.04%+1.31%+151.12%+525.25% 33.08B
-0.79%-1.38%-9.75%-8.93% 29.91B
+0.41%+1.44%+96.60%+259.02% 29.81B
Average +0.79%+3.04%+81.27%+280.47% 46.36B
Weighted average by Cap. +0.80%+3.08%+76.13%+261.71%

Financials

2025 *2026 *
Net sales 10.45B 14.26B 12.01B 10.96B 19.42B 1,293B 20.17B 127B 50.44B 622B 53.42B 52.36B 2,179B 10.78B 14.71B 12.39B 11.3B 20.03B 1,334B 20.8B 131B 52.03B 642B 55.1B 54.01B 2,248B
Net income 220M 301M 253M 231M 410M 27.27B 425M 2.68B 1.06B 13.12B 1.13B 1.1B 45.96B 236M 322M 272M 248M 439M 29.23B 456M 2.88B 1.14B 14.06B 1.21B 1.18B 49.26B
Net Debt -942M -1.29B -1.08B -988M -1.75B -117B -1.82B -11.47B -4.55B -56.09B -4.82B -4.72B -196B -1.03B -1.41B -1.19B -1.08B -1.92B -128B -2B -12.58B -4.99B -61.54B -5.28B -5.18B -216B
Logo Balfour Beatty plc
Balfour Beatty plc is a United Kingdom-based international infrastructure group. The Company finances, develops, builds, maintains, and operates the complex and critical infrastructure. It operates through three segments: Construction Services, Support Services, and Infrastructure Investments. The Construction Services segment includes activities resulting in the physical construction of an asset. The Support Services segment includes activities that support existing assets or functions, such as asset maintenance and refurbishment. The Infrastructure Investments segment is engaged in the acquisition, operation, and disposal of infrastructure assets, such as roads, hospitals, student accommodation, military housing, multifamily residences, offshore transmission networks, waste and biomass and other concessions. This segment also includes the housing development division. Its projects include Swanswell Viaduct project, M60 Palatine Road Bridge project, Project Hercules, and others.
Employees
27,311
Date Price Change Volume
26-02-13 766.50 p +1.12% 1,135,537
26-02-12 758.00 p +0.53% 1,042,928
26-02-11 754.00 p +0.94% 749,658
26-02-10 747.00 p -1.19% 1,595,689
26-02-09 756.00 p +1.61% 2,232,973
Sell
Consensus
Buy
Mean consensus
BUY
Number of Analysts
8
Last Close Price
7.665GBP
Average target price
7.462GBP
Spread / Average Target
-2.64%

Quarterly revenue - Rate of surprise